Tisbury, MA is a small town located on Martha's Vineyard, which is accessible via ferry. It is an ideal location for people who want to experience a peaceful and quaint atmosphere away from the city hustle and bustle. Public transportation in Tisbury is provided by Island Transport, which offers both fixed routes and on-demand services. The fixed route service operates seven days a week and includes stops at the main towns along Martha's Vineyard. On-demand services are available on all days except Holidays and allow customers to set their own pick-up and drop-off locations throughout the island. Additionally, taxi services are also offered in Tisbury for those who need quick transportation from one place to another. All in all, public transportation options in Tisbury are quite convenient and reliable for residents and visitors alike.

The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in Tisbury takes 14.6 minutes. That's shorter than the US average of 26.4 minutes.

How people in Tisbury get to work:
- 67.9% drive their own car alone
- 3.4% carpool with others
- 7.3% work from home
- 6.0% take mass transit
